## Service Accounts — TerraTrek Offline Mode

When TerraTrek field surveyors lose connectivity, the app queues observations locally and syncs via the svc-terratrek-offline account once a signal returns. Support staff diagnosing stuck sync queues should confirm the device clock is within five minutes of server time, as drift causes token rejection. Escalations beyond that require replaying the queue through the Harborline ingest service directly. For that replay, use the key below.

gateway credential: kto23_LX9A4ys6i4nzHtpOLNLodKK

# Onboarding: Calendar Sync Conflicts

Meshly syncs tenant calendars every 15 minutes. If a user reports duplicate or vanished events, check the conflict log first — most cases are double-linked accounts. To pull conflict logs from the sync node, authenticate with the deploy key provided below.

release key, hahig-tahop: bky9_M2QMJ6LkR

Hardware Lab Access — Reception Notes

Visitors to the Corvane Systems hardware lab on Level 2 must be escorted by a lab technician at all times. Reception staff may open the outer vestibule door for deliveries only. The inner lab door requires the current pass code, which rotates quarterly. The code in effect this quarter is below.

door code, yagap-bahof: bdg-O-05